Hi everyone,

I installed a Helium RAK hotspot on my Orbi Network and Armor is blocking all traffic to it.

I tried to set it IP on the DMZ but still no go.

It there a way to make an Exclusion on Armor so it does not block a specific device / IP on my network ?

I think it is a problem with ARMOR

 

The IP address is an assigned static address from my Orbi ... I already setup my LAN to use  the 192.168.33.xxx subnet

 

My modem is what Spectrum provides and it is in bridged mode so I can see the public address on the WAN side of the Orbi Router

 

I am surprised that ORBI / ARMOR does not provide an option to bypass ALL Traffic To/From a specific IP on the LAN

 

Even setting the HotSpot IP address on the Orbi DMZ did not push an exception to the ARMOR to allow it to send/receive traffic
